Alameda County, California
Population, Census, April 1, 2020 1,682,353
People
Population
Population estimates, July 1, 2025, (V2025) 1,636,630
Population estimates, July 1, 2024, (V2024) 1,649,060
Population estimates base, April 1, 2020, (V2025) 1,682,246
Population estimates base, April 1, 2020, (V2024) 1,682,296
Population, percent change - April 1, 2020 (estimates base) to July 1, 2025, (V2025) -2.7%
Population, percent change - April 1, 2020 (estimates base) to July 1, 2024, (V2024) -2.0%
Population, Census, April 1, 2020 1,682,353
Population, Census, April 1, 2010 1,510,271
Age and Sex
Persons under 5 years, percent 5.0%
Persons under 18 years, percent 19.2%
Persons 65 years and over, percent 16.4%
Female persons, percent 50.4%
Race and Hispanic Origin
White alone, percent 46.2%
Black alone, percent(a) 10.3%
American Indian and Alaska Native alone, percent(a) 1.4%
Asian alone, percent(a) 35.5%
Native Hawaiian and Other Pacific Islander alone, percent(a) 0.9%
Two or More Races, percent 5.7%
Hispanic or Latino, percent(b) 23.6%
White alone, not Hispanic or Latino, percent 27.1%
Population Characteristics
Veterans, 2020-2024 39,894
Foreign-born persons, percent, 2020-2024 34.7%
Housing
Housing Units, July 1, 2025, (V2025) 655,191
Owner-occupied housing unit rate, 2020-2024 54.4%
Median value of owner-occupied housing units, 2020-2024 $1,090,100
Median selected monthly owner costs - with a mortgage, 2020-2024 $3,810
Median selected monthly owner costs - without a mortage, 2020-2024 $1,000
Median gross rent, 2020-2024 $2,357
Building Permits, 2025 2,778
Families & Living Arrangements
Households, 2020-2024 598,246
Persons per household, 2020-2024 2.70
Living in the same house 1 year ago, percent of persons age 1 year+ , 2020-2024 87.9%
Language other than English spoken at home, percent of persons age 5 years+, 2020-2024 47.2%
Computer and Internet Use
Households with a computer, percent, 2020-2024 97.4%
Households with a broadband Internet subscription, percent, 2020-2024 94.4%
Education
High school graduate or higher, percent of persons age 25 years+, 2020-2024 88.8%
Bachelor's degree or higher, percent of persons age 25 years+, 2020-2024 52.2%
Health
With a disability, under age 65 years, percent, 2020-2024 6.7%
Persons without health insurance, under age 65 years, percent 4.8%
Economy
In civilian labor force, total, percent of population age 16 years+, 2020-2024 66.7%
In civilian labor force, female, percent of population age 16 years+, 2020-2024 61.7%
Total accommodation and food services sales, 2022 ($1,000)(c) 5,935,138
Total health care and social assistance receipts/revenue, 2022 ($1,000)(c) 22,245,438
Total transportation and warehousing receipts/revenue, 2022 ($1,000)(c) 8,666,569
Total retail sales, 2022 ($1,000)(c) 32,269,688
Total retail sales per capita, 2022(c) $19,819
Transportation
Mean travel time to work (minutes), workers age 16 years+, 2020-2024 31.0
Income & Poverty
Median households income (in 2024 dollars), 2020-2024 $129,367
Per capita income in past 12 months (in 2024 dollars), 2020-2024 $65,862
Persons in poverty, percent 8.8%
Businesses
Businesses
Total employer establishments, 2023 42,318
Total employment, 2023 749,124
Total annual payroll, 2023 ($1,000) 75,849,017
Total employment, percent change, 2022-2023 3.9%
Total nonemployer establishments, 2023 140,901
All employer firms, Reference year 2023 33,847
Male-owned employer firms, Reference year 2023 18,988
Female-owned employer firms, Reference year 2023 8,182
Minority-owned employer firms, Reference year 2023 16,033
Nonminority-owned employer firms, Reference year 2023 14,216
Veteran-owned employer firms, Reference year 2023 S
Nonveteran-owned employer firms, Reference year 2023 30,272
Geography
Geography
Population per square mile, 2020 2,281.3
Population per square mile, 2010 2,043.6
Land area in square miles, 2020 737.46
Land area in square miles, 2010 739.02
FIPS Code 06001
